1. Check That Your Power Bank Has Clear Capacity Marking

Your power bank must have either an “mAh” or a “Wh” marking on the exterior. Security officers need to verify the capacity quickly. Some regional carriers even require specific certification labels; hence, it’s important to buy power banks from reputable brands like oraimo that clearly label their products. Cheap knockoff power banks may lack proper markings, causing serious delays at the airport.

2. Always Pack Your Power Bank in Hand Luggage

This is a golden rule you must follow regarding a power bank on a plane. Airlines completely ban power banks from checked baggage. The reason is clear: lithium batteries can catch fire if damaged or short-circuited. In the cargo hold where nobody monitors, a small fire can turn into a disaster. But in the cabin, crew members can quickly handle any emergency. The pressure and temperature changes in the cargo hold can also affect your power bank’s performance. So, whether your flight is a short Lagos to Abuja trip or a long haul to London, your power bank must stay with you in the cabin.

3. Use Your Power Bank at the Right Time

Timing is very important when using your power bank on board. Most airlines have strict rules about electronic devices during critical flight phases. You can only use your power bank before boarding or after the plane reaches cruising altitude, but not during take-off and landing. This rule helps reduce interference with aircraft navigation systems. Once the seatbelt sign turns off and you reach a stable altitude, you can use your power bank on a plane to charge your devices.
